Ilofmami's Hop Fills have been used in thousands of tiie worst eases of fever and ague, intermittent fevers and dumb ague, with astonishing success. They are offered to the public with full 'confidence in their merit. They do not contain poisonous or injurious properties, and ran he taken by adult or child with perfect safety. They are sugar coated, and for sale by druggists at 50 cents •per box, or sent by mail prepaid. 5-30 Cm
LEGAL ADVERTISEMENTS Sheriff’s Sale. BY virtue of a copy of decree and execution to me directed from tlie Clerk of the Jasper Cirenit eonrl. I will expose at public salt) to tlie highest bidder on Saturday, the 13th day of September, 1873, between the hours ot 10 o’clock A M. and 4 o’clock Pv M. of said day, at the door of the-Court House of Jasper county, the rents and profits for a term of not exceeding seven years, of the following described real estate, to-wit: Tlie northwest quarter of tlie northeast quarter of section four (4), in township twenty eight ~28), north, of range seven (7)* west, ail in Jasper Cuuuty, Indiana, and on failure to realize the full amount of judgment, interest and Co3’s, 1 will at the same time and plrco expose at public salo the fee simple of said real estate. Taken as the property of Moriis Thomas and Mary A. Thomas at the suit of Simon P. Thompso i Said sale will be made without relief from valuation or appraisement law*. LEWIS L. DAUGHERTY, Aug. 18, 1873. ‘ Sheriff Jasp-r county. Thompson dj. Bro., AU’ys for Pl’tfV l - > ‘ 5-48-31. > _ - Notice of Sale of Real Estate.
